The Chair of Industrial Management presented two recent research papers at the renowned innovation conference of the International Society for Professional Innovation Management (ISPIM) in Florence. Marie-Christin Schmidt talked about “Kick-Start for Connectivity – How to Implement Digital Platforms successfully“, a paper co-authored by Johannes Veile, Prof. Dr. Julian Müller, and Prof. Dr. Kai-Ingo Voigt. Oscar Pakos discussed research findings on “Understanding the Mechanismis of Activity-based Workspaces: A Case Study“, a paper co-authored by Tobias Eismann, Marc Rücker, Dr. Martin Meinel, Lukas Maier and Prof. Dr. Kai-Ingo Voigt. Many international researchers followed their presentations interestedly and subsequently discussed fascinating aspects in plenary.
